    • Looks like a scam. It has all the telltale signs: - The "business" doesn't have a physical address or really any kind information listed - It's using a generic online store website template - The prices are ridiculously reduced. To good to be true cheap - Everything is in stock and can be ordered in any possible combination   I've seen a few of these for other products as well. Things like sunglasses for example. I'd say stay away from it! And maybe reach out to the real theskylineshed and let them know this exists. I doubt there is much they can do about it, but still.   I don't know if they would actually take your money if you ordered something. Or whether it is just for collecting credit card details to scam otherwise. I'm not game enough to try it.

    • Got the flat door cards "good enough" for now. After cutting out the arm rest I removed all the stock trim material. Then filled the gap with a bit of Masonite and wrapped it in some adhesive foam to hide the  transitions as much as possible. Then I applied some black vinyl material to the panel with some spray on contact adhesive smoothing the edges as best as I could. Here is how it sits in the car with the door handle and cut down window switch mounted
